A Foundry Worker is responsible for performing various tasks in a foundry setting to produce metal castings. This role involves operating machinery, monitoring production processes, and ensuring the quality of finished products. Foundry Workers must adhere to safety guidelines and maintain a clean and organized work environment.
Key Responsibilities:
- Operate foundry equipment such as furnaces, molds, ladles, and pouring devices.
- Monitor temperature, pressure, and other variables to control the casting process.
- Prepare molds by assembling, coating, and positioning them for pouring.
- Pour molten metal into molds according to production requirements.
- Remove finished castings from molds, using tools such as hammers, chisels, and grinders.
- Inspect castings for defects, such as cracks or surface imperfections, and make necessary adjustments.
- Clean and maintain equipment to ensure proper functioning and safety.
- Follow safety procedures to prevent accidents and injuries.
- Collaborate with team members to meet production targets and deadlines.
- Maintain accurate records of production activities, including quantities produced and any issues encountered.
